Want a bright and vibrant blush pink Tradescantia Nanouk? The key is sunlight. The more light the Nanouk receives, the brighter pink it’ll be. BUT just remember to acclimate the Nanouk to sunlight gradually. Too abrupt and too much will burn the leaves. Gradually expose it to a couple of hours of sunlight every day and it’ll acclimate. I started with morning direct sunlight as it’s not too harsh.
